Defining the Metrics: Body mass index (BMI) is a widely used metric for assessing weight status. This calculation, which utilizes an individual's weight and height, offers a relative measure of body fat distribution. However, the BMI calculation isn't without limitations. It's crucial to recognize that BMI is a simplified proxy, prone to inaccuracies when considering individuals with certain skeletal structures or high muscle mass. For example, athletes with significant muscle mass might be categorized as overweight by BMI despite being in excellent health.
Overweight and Obesity: Obesity is a condition characterized by excessive accumulation of body fat, posing considerable risks to an individual's health. Overweight is a term referring to a body weight higher than is typically considered healthy for a given height and age. These conditions can lead to a range of health problems, including cardiovascular disease, type 2 diabetes, and certain types of cancer. The causal relationship between weight status and these health issues is well-documented by various research entities like the NHLBI.
Underweight: Conversely, underweight denotes a body weight significantly lower than what is considered healthy for a given height and age. This can stem from various factors, including eating disorders, certain medical conditions, or insufficient caloric intake. Underweight can likewise have adverse effects on health. Reduced immunity, impaired growth, and nutrient deficiencies are amongst potential complications.
The Role of the BMI Calculator: Utilizing a BMI calculator is a convenient method for obtaining a preliminary assessment of one's weight status relative to height. These tools, accessible online and in many health applications, allow for a quick calculation based on simple input. Though convenient, using the BMI to draw definitive conclusions is inappropriate. The BMI calculator should be used as a preliminary indicator that necessitates further evaluation by a qualified healthcare professional.
